0
사용자가 보고서를 예약 할 수 있지만 동시에 모든 작업을 예약 할 수있는 시스템이 있습니다.Quartz 스케줄러에서 큐를 구현하는 방법은 무엇입니까?
동시에 예약 된 작업이 하나씩 동시에 실행되지 않는 쿼 츠에서 대기열 처리 시스템을 구현하려면 어떻게해야합니까?
사용자가 보고서를 예약 할 수 있지만 동시에 모든 작업을 예약 할 수있는 시스템이 있습니다.Quartz 스케줄러에서 큐를 구현하는 방법은 무엇입니까?
동시에 예약 된 작업이 하나씩 동시에 실행되지 않는 쿼 츠에서 대기열 처리 시스템을 구현하려면 어떻게해야합니까?
당신이있는 거 필요 클러스터 모드로, Cluster Jobs
나는 이것이 다중 Scheduler 인스턴스를 처리하기위한 디자인이라고 생각한다. 내 시스템에는 1 개의 인스턴스 만 있습니다. – aeycee
순차적 작업처럼 보인다 다음 문서를 참조하십시오 작업을 실행합니다. 이벤트 중심 접근 방식을 고려하지 않는 이유는 무엇입니까? 하나의 작업을 완료하면 하나의 이벤트가 시작됩니다. – NewUser
나는 이것을 시도 할 수있다.하지만 Quartz Scheduler로 이것을 어떻게 구현할 수 있을지 모르겠다. – aeycee
각 단일 보고서에 대해 새 작업을 예약하는 대신 하나의 전역 작업 만 주기적으로 실행하도록 예약하고 해당 작업이 대기중인 보고서를 검색하여 하나씩 생성하도록합니다. 보고서 대기열은 간단한 DB 테이블 또는 JMS 대기열 또는 메모리 내 개체 또는 전자 메일 계정 일 수 있습니다. – walen